Experiencing a knocked-out tooth is usually a shocking and distressing scenario. Whether brought on by a sports injury, an accident, or a fall, shedding a tooth can lead to immediate ache and concern concerning the aesthetic impact in your smile. In such moments, understanding that a Johnstown emergency dentist can provide swift and efficient care is significant.


The first step after losing a tooth is to find the knocked-out tooth, if possible. It is crucial to handle it carefully, solely by the crown and not the foundation. Immediate actions can considerably influence the finish result of re-implantation. Rinse the tooth gently with water to remove dirt, however do not scrub it or use soap as this could damage the tissues.


If the tooth is undamaged, try to place it again into the socket. This can often be the most fitted choice for maintaining the tooth viable. If that’s not attainable, store the tooth in a container full of milk or saline answer. This helps to maintain the tooth moist and preserve the vitality of the cells. Avoid storing the tooth in plain water, as this might cause the cells to rupture.

After stabilizing the tooth, contacting an emergency dentist in Johnstown becomes crucial. Time is of the essence when it comes to re-implanting a knocked-out tooth, with the highest success rates occurring within the first hour after the loss. An emergency dentist will assess the state of affairs completely and determine one of the best course of action.


Re-implantation is not the only solution that an emergency dentist can provide. Depending on the time that has elapsed and the condition of the tooth, other treatments may be instructed. This may vary from a dental bridge or implant to different restorative procedures. The dentist will talk about all out there options, permitting you to make an informed determination about your care.




Pain management is another important facet of receiving emergency dental care. A knocked-out tooth can lead to swelling and discomfort, necessitating immediate attention to alleviate these symptoms. Over-the-counter pain relievers could be effective, however it's sensible to consult together with your dentist concerning one of the best treatment to use and applicable dosages.
